找到 8590 篇文章 相关前端技术

如何编写 JavaScript 正则表达式以进行多次匹配?

Nikitha N
更新于 2020-06-23 05:37:40

138 次浏览

要查找多个匹配项,请编写 JavaScript 正则表达式。您可以尝试运行以下代码以实现多个匹配的正则表达式 -示例                    var url = 'https://www.example.com/new.html?ui=7&demo=one&demo=two&demo=three four',          a = document.createElement('a');          a.href = url;          var demoRegex = /(?:^|[&;])demo=([^&;]+)/g,          matches,          demo = [];          while (matches = demoRegex.exec(a.search)) {             demo.push(decodeURIComponent(matches[1]));          }          document.write(demo);                  

如何在 JavaScript 中编写正则表达式以删除空格?

Anvi Jain
更新于 2020-06-23 05:40:28

194 次浏览

要在 JavaScript 中删除空格,您可以尝试运行以下正则表达式。它会从字符串中删除空格 -示例 实时演示                    var str = "Welcome to Tutorialspoint";          document.write(str);                    //删除空格          document.write(""+str.replace(/\s/g, ''));                       输出

如何使用 JavaScript RegExp 替换字符串?

Prabhdeep Singh
更新于 2022-11-07 06:24:32

3K+ 次浏览

在本教程中,我们将探讨如何使用 JavaScript 中的正则表达式替换字符串中的特定子字符串。有时我们可能希望用其他内容替换字符串中的重复子字符串。在这种情况下,正则表达式可能会有所帮助。在将它们用于解决我们当前的问题之前,让我们看看正则表达式到底是什么。正则表达式基本上是字符模式,可用于在字符串中搜索该模式的不同出现。正则表达式使我们能够在数据流中搜索特定模式... 阅读更多

JavaScript 中的异常处理是如何工作的?

Vrundesha Joshi
更新于 2020-06-22 14:38:52

136 次浏览

JavaScript 使用 try…catch…finally 来处理异常。最新版本的 JavaScript 添加了异常处理功能。JavaScript 实现了 try...catch...finally 结构以及 throw 运算符来处理异常。您可以捕获程序员生成的异常和运行时异常,但您无法捕获 JavaScript 语法错误。语法以下是 try...catch...finally 块语法 -     示例您可以尝试运行以下代码以了解 JavaScript 中如何处理异常 -                                         单击以下内容以查看结果:                          

JavaScript 中的自执行匿名函数是什么?

Rishi Rathor
更新于 2020-06-22 14:39:42

406 次浏览

在 JavaScript 中,用括号括起来的函数称为“立即调用函数表达式”或“自执行函数”。包装的目的是命名空间和控制成员函数的可见性。它将代码包装在函数范围内,并减少与其他库的冲突。这就是我们所说的立即调用函数表达式 (IIFE) 或自执行匿名函数。语法以下是语法 -(function() {    // 代码 })();如您在上面看到的,以下括号对将括号内的代码转换为表达式 -function(){...}此外,下一对,即第二对括号继续操作。... 阅读更多

如何使用 Function() 构造函数定义 JavaScript 函数?

Nikitha N
更新于 2020-06-22 14:42:23

119 次浏览

Function() 构造函数接受任意数量的字符串参数。最后一个参数是函数体 - 它可以包含任意 JavaScript 语句,这些语句之间用分号分隔。示例您可以尝试运行以下代码以使用新的 Function 构造函数调用函数 -                    var func = new Function("x", "y", "return x*y;");          function multiplyFunction(){             var result;             result = func(15,35);             document.write ( result );          }                     单击以下按钮以调用函数                          

在 JavaScript 中定义函数的不同方法是什么?

Shubham Vora
更新于 2022-11-15 09:27:24

789 次浏览

在本教程中,我们将学习在 JavaScript 中定义函数的不同方法。在编程中,一遍又一遍地编写相同的代码不是一个好主意。它会增加长度并降低可读性,并且程序需要付出更多努力。编程语言中的函数是为了让程序员更容易。函数就像一个容器,里面包含某些程序行。仅定义函数不会执行它。我们必须在程序中的某个地方调用它,这样它才能运行它包含的代码。我们可以... 阅读更多

JavaScript 函数中的可选参数是什么?

Daniol Thomas
更新于 2020-06-22 14:42:54

197 次浏览

要在 JavaScript 中声明可选函数参数,请使用“默认”参数。示例您可以尝试运行以下代码以声明可选参数 -                    // 默认设置为 1          function inc(val1, inc = 1) {             return val1 + inc;          }          document.write(inc(10,10));          document.write("");          document.write(inc(10));          

“use strict”在 JavaScript 中的作用是什么,背后的原因是什么?

Shubham Vora
更新于 2022-10-31 11:42:23

190 次浏览

在本教程中,我们将学习“use strict”在 JavaScript 中的作用。 “use strict”是一个指令。JavaScript 1.8.5 是它的起源。“use strict”指令表示 JavaScript 代码必须在严格模式下运行。严格指令不是语句,而是一个常量表达式。早期版本的 JavaScript 会忽略此表达式。在严格模式下编写代码时,我们不能使用未声明的变量。除了 IE9 及以下版本,所有现代浏览器都支持此 JavaScript 指令。严格模式允许我们编写更简洁的代码,因为它在我们在严格模式下使用未声明的变量时会抛出错误... 阅读更多

Chrome 中的 JavaScript 函数定义?我该如何找到它?

Giri Raju
更新于 2020-06-22 14:33:58

4K+ 次浏览

要在 Google Chrome 中查找 JavaScript 函数定义,请打开 Web 浏览器并按 F12 进入开发者工具。现在按 Ctrl + Shift + F选中正则表达式,如下所示 -搜索函数,就是这样。

广告